What companies run services between Flinders Street Station, VIC, Australia and Keilor, VIC, Australia?

There is no direct connection from Flinders Street Station to Keilor. However, you can take the train to Essendon Station, walk to Essendon Station/Russell St, then take the line 476 bus to Parramatta Rd/Old Calder Hwy.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Flinders Street Station to Melville Cl/Old Calder Hwy via Town Hall Station, Watergardens Station, and Watergardens Station/Watergardens Circuit Rd in around 1h 21m.
